What nobody is about wanting this
Nobody wants this follows the story of Joanne, an agnostic and independent podcast presenter, played by Kristen Bell. His life changes when he meets Noah, an unconventional rabbi embodied by Adam Brody. Despite their Religious differences and opposite lifestylesboth are attracted and decide to try a relationship.
What begins as a fortuitous encounter is transformed into a love story full of obstacles, where the couple must deal with their own insecurities, the opinion of their entrometry families and the conflicts that arise from their different beliefs. The series explores issues such as commitment, identity and compatibility in modern relationships, always with a touch of Intelligent and situational humor.

When the second season comes out
At the end of the series of 10 chaptersNoah and Joanne decide to give their relationship a chance, despite the evidence they suggest that joining their lives will be almost impossible. According to the creator of the series, Erin Foster, the second season will continue where the first one.
For what is known, This February began the recordings of the second part. So it is expected to come out by the end of the year or early 2026.
